1

The Greatest Guide To pet store dubai

News Discuss 
 These stores Have a very wider array of products and solutions and can be a a single-stop shop for all your dog wants. In terms of discovering the best pet shops in Dubai, pet owners are regularly on the lookout for major-notch establishments that cater to the requires of their https://bertiej789urn7.bloggerswise.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story